Treorchy station might not have a ticket office, but it makes up with accessible ticket machines that accept major debit and credit cards, ensuring you can collect tickets bought online with ease. While the station doesn't issue smartcards, validators are available for commuters who carry them. Travelers who rely on technology for travel planning will be pleased to know that public Wi-Fi is accessible—helping you stay connected while you wait for your train.
For those requiring assistance, there's a help point available. Travel information is displayed on departure and arrival screens, and announcements keep passengers updated on the latest travel news. Unfortunately, there's no waiting room, but a seating area offers some comfort as you wait for your ride. Access around the station is partially step-free, with a ramp with a steep gradient available from Station Road. It's important to plan ahead if you require full accessibility support.
Treorchy station is seamlessly connected to public transport. For times when rail services might be disrupted, a rail replacement service operates towards Pontypridd near the Prince of Wales pub and towards Treherbert near Morgan's Barbers on the A4058. While the station lacks designated spaces or equipment for aiding passenger's mobility in its car park, it offers free parking with 24-hour access.

You won't find a ticket office here, but there are 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ting tickets. This is perfect for those who prefer the flexibility of buying tickets online. Accessibility is a key factor at Kempton Park, with ticket machines supporting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Should you need assistance, use the help points located within the station, where staff are happy to assist via help lines. Keep in mind there are no waiting rooms, toilets, or refreshment facilities, so it's best to plan ahead if you need any of these services.
Traveling beyond Kempton Park Station is a breeze with various transport links. The station provides clear information for bus routes, including maps for planning your onward journey. If rail service faces any disruptions, rail replacement services run toward Shepperton and Fulwell from Staines Road East.
